参加了学校的小车比赛,打算用STM32F746VET6做主控,转接板都焊好了。。我参加这个比赛的同时现在也在做飞思卡尔。。。。现在我想用一个SPI接口的液晶屏来实时显示小车获取的一些传感器信息(不用总线刷是因为懒得接那么多接口、、没有太多速度要求、、而且由于这个单片机频率高,,SPI也可以刷得很快。),,然而这款液晶屏只有F103的例程。。用的是STM32F103 v3.5的标准库,,。那么问题来了,,怎么移植到f7上。
串口屏在F103上的的例程
STM32F7的一个程序
SPI的串口屏
STM32F746VET6的转接板 |
| 时序还是要注意下的,分频啥的。SPI速度可以更快,关键是屏幕能不能支持 |
| 都用上F746了 高大上 |
| 我是来学习的 |
| 高大上的片子啊,需要修改的地方很多呢,库都不一样,F7估计只有HAL库吧 |
| 估计要重新写把。f7是不支持位带操作的,如果你的程序中有位带操作,那部分就要重新写咯。哈哈 |
| 其实接口部分的程序应该没几句替换一下就行。甚至F7如果上emwin的话,我怀疑支持很多屏幕的LCM,所以直接支持。 |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() :) |
| 用F7的自带的例程试下,SPI接口的LCD |
微信公众号
手机版